Manager Corporate and Executive Compensation - Veralto

New Jersey, Newbrunswick, 08901 Newbrunswick USA

Vacancy expired!

Your Responsibilities:

Advice on the various compensation life cycle events including annual merit planning, variable pay (ICP) administration, and equity processes.

Perform intermediate to advanced analytics to inform compensation and benefits projects and program audits.

Apply the Global Career and Reward Framework, providing guidance to the organization around job mapping and leveling and participate in GCRF governance.

Train HR and business leaders on compensation philosophy, strategy, and practice to improve efficiency and quality of compensation processes. In addition, assist HR and business leaders on employment related matters that impact compensation and benefits such as collaborating with work councils, identifying when U.S.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) reviews might be necessary, discussing pay transparency and other internal policies.

Conduct any additional duties as required.

Your Attributes

Bachelor’s degree with 9+ years’ experience, or Master’s degree in field with 7+ years’ experience

Previous experience driving the annual compensation process either as a compensation analyst or HR business partner preferred

Knowledge of compensation practices and principles and the changing global regulatory landscape

Excellent interpersonal, written, and oral communication skills. Ability to communicate to different audiences at various levels of the organization, globally.

Strong project management skills

Travel:

Travel required <10%
